Prabowo Prioritizes Forest Fire Handling in IKN, Says Minister - Tempo.co English
T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The Minister of Forestry, Raja Juli Antoni, said the core area of the Nusantara Capital City, or IKN, remains a priority for the Indonesian government in handling the forest fires that have raged near the area for weeks.
“Bapak President [Prabowo Subianto] pays special concern for East Kalimantan because of IKN,” Juli said in a written statement on Tuesday, September 15, 2026.
The IKN authority earlier announced that the air quality in the Central Government Core Area (KIPP) in the new capital remains in good condition based on the "Air Quality Index" measurements. Air quality is one of the key concerns to protect the core area of IKN from the impact of forest and land fires.
In terms of security, the IKN authority is working with the Ministry of Forestry, the National Disaster Management Agency (BNPB), the Indonesian National Armed Forces (TNI), and the Indonesian National Police.
Meanwhile, on Monday, September 14, 2026, the East Kalimantan provincial government inspected the burned areas in Bukit Tengkorak, including the areas in Bukit Soeharto Grand Forest Park.
The Head of the IKN Authority, Basuki Hadimuljono, stated that the authority is pushing for increased ground patrols and readiness of firefighting equipment to strengthen efforts in preventing and handling forest and land fires around the IKN area.
“Additionally, equipment assistance is needed for some fire brigades,” Basuki said.
